Property Report
This property, located at 32, Fermor Road, SE23 2HN, is a mid-terrace house built before 1900. The house has a floor area of 117 square meters and is partially double-glazed. Its energy rating is 'D', indicating a moderate level of energy efficiency. The property has mains gas for heating and hot water, with a current heating cost of £2736 per annum. The estimated annual running costs are £1396. The property has six heated rooms and three fireplaces.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 979 out of 999.
